I was just wondering what equiptment I need to start using vinyl timecodes with Virtual DJ? I already have an RMX, and I'm planning on buying VDJ pro, 2 direct drive turntables (TT200's), and 2 timecoded vinyls (Suggestions on what to buy? I'm a bit clueless). Do I need an external box like virtual vinyl/serato scratch? or will that set up work fine.

And also, is using timecoded vinyls particuarly demanding on a computer compared to just using the RMX as a midi controller? I do sometimes get a bit of lag when im recording on VDJ and mixing with my RMX...

The RMX is a soundcard so no you don't need anything else, just timecode vinyls, apparently traktor make the best ones which are 2000Hz, but I have never used them, I use Serato which are 1000Hz
 

Cheers mate. So for VDJ I can use Serato and Traktor timecode vinyls?
Ermm, also, do you have any idea how demanding it is for your computer?

Cheers : )
 

I have never not used timecodes so can't directly compare, but I use them with an audio 8 soundcard, laptop has 4gb ram core duo 2.4ghz and I never have any problems, I can scratch, beatjuggle and mix with no issues, although you do need to keep your equipment clean, as the signal can drift if you have dirty needles/vinyl, only +/- 0.2 at most but it does get annoying enough to buy new vinyl every 5-6 months
